Centos Centos 8 Cloud DevOps Owncloud

Cara Install OwnCloud pada CentOS 8

OwnCloud

“Cara Install OwnCloud pada CentOS 8

OwnCloud adalah platform cloud open-source untuk mengelola dan berbagi file. Ini dapat digunakan sebagai alternatif untuk Dropbox, Microsoft OneDrive, dan Google Drive. ownCloud dapat diperluas melalui aplikasi dan memiliki klien desktop dan seluler untuk semua platform utama.

Persiapan

Cara Install ownCloud pada CentOS 8

1. Buat Database

mysql -u root -p
  • Buat Databses
CREATE DATABASE owncloud CHARACTER SET utf8mb4 COLLATE utf8mb4_general_ci;

GRANT ALL ON owncloud.* TO 'ownclouduser'@'localhost' IDENTIFIED BY 'change-with-strong-password';

EXIT;

2. Install apache dan php modul

  • install package
dnf install php php-curl php-gd php-intl php-json php-ldap php-mbstring php-mysqlnd php-xml php-zip php-opcache 
  • restart service
systemctl restart php-fpm
systemctl restart httpd

3. Download Owncloud

wget https://download.owncloud.org/community/owncloud-10.3.2.tar.bz2 -P /tmp

tar jxf /tmp/owncloud-10.3.2.tar.bz2 -C /var/www

chown -R apache: /var/www/owncloud

4. Konfigurasi Apache

nano /etc/httpd/conf.d/owncloud.conf
Alias /owncloud "/var/www/owncloud/"

<Directory /var/www/owncloud/>
  Options +FollowSymlinks
  AllowOverride All

 <IfModule mod_dav.c>
  Dav off
 </IfModule>

 SetEnv HOME /var/www/owncloud
 SetEnv HTTP_HOME /var/www/owncloud

</Directory>
systemctl restart httpd

5. Setup Owncloud

  • akses Via web
https://domain_name_or_ip_address/owncloud
  • Masukan user , password , info database yang telah di buat. Klik Finish setup.

6. Tambahkan rule Firewall

sudo firewall-cmd --zone=public --add-port=80/tcp
sudo firewall-cmd --zone=public --add-port=443/tcp
sudo firewall-cmd --runtime-to-permanent

Sahabat Blog Learning & Doing demikianlah penjelasan mengenai Cara Install ownCloud pada CentOS 8. Semoga Bermanfaat . Sampai ketemu lagi di postingan berikut nya.

Klik untuk berbagi dengan orang lain
Baca Juga :  Cara Install Mysql pada Linux Mint Cinnamon

Similar Posts